Art Nouveau Seabed Repoussé Box by Alfred Daguet
Located in Chicago, US
Daguet’s beautifully patinated cash box is a rich textural and colorful tour de force. So much more than an adaptation of Japanese wood block print sources to his metalwork craft, Daguet created a veritable 3-dimensional metal aquarium to charm the Paris market. And in typical fashion, Daguet’s marine-themed box not only provided a visual delight, it furnished an artful oceanic context from which the prevailing schools of social thought could swim.The top of Daguet’s box...
